It's a good idea to set up your lights, turn them on for a while, and then figure out just how much air flow you'll require to keep a comfortable temperature level for your plants. This will enable you to select an exhaust fan ideal for your requirements. If the odor of cannabis plants in flower will cause you issues, add a charcoal filter to your exhaust fan.

Finally, it's a great idea to have a constant light breeze in your grow room as this reinforces your plants' stems and creates a less hospitable environment for mold and flying insects. A wall-mounted flowing fan works well for this purpose-- just don't point it directly at your plants, because that can cause windburn.

While there are sophisticated (and pricey) units available that control lights, temperature level, humidity, and CO2 levels, the newbie will typically need an easy 24 hr timer for the light and an adjustable thermostat switch for the exhaust fan. The timing of the light/dark cycle is really important when growing marijuana; typically you will have your lights on for 16-20 hours per 24 hour duration while the plants remain in vegetative development, then change to 12 hours of light per 24 when you want them to bloom.

You can use a timer for your exhaust fan also, however investing a few extra dollars on a thermostat switch is a much better alternative. With one of the most fundamental designs, you merely set the thermostat on the gadget to the optimum wanted temperature for your space and plug your exhaust fan into it.

This conserves energy and preserves a constant temperature. Considering that you're most likely not investing many of your time in your grow space, a mix hygrometer/thermostat with high/low memory feature can be really useful in keeping tabs on conditions in your space. These small, low-cost devices not just reveal you the current temperature and humidity level, however the highest and lowest readings for the period of time considering that you last examined.

Cannabis chooses a pH between 6 and 7 in soil, and between 5.5 and 6.5 in hydroponic media. Letting the pH leave this range can lead to nutrition lockout, meaning your plants are not able to absorb the nutrients they need, so be sure to test your water and soil routinely and make sure the nutrient mix you are feeding your plants falls within the preferred variety.

Soil is the most standard medium for growing cannabis inside your home, in addition to the most flexible, making it a good option for newbie growers. Any high quality potting soil will work, as long as it doesn't include artificial extended release fertilizer (like Wonder Gro), which disagrees for growing great cannabis.

Indoor growers are increasingly relying on soilless, hydroponic media for cultivating marijuana plants. This technique needs feeding with concentrated services of mineral salt nutrients that are soaked up directly by the roots through the procedure of osmosis. The method for quicker nutrient uptake leading to faster growth and bigger yields, however it likewise requires a higher order of precision as plants are quicker to react to over or underfeeding and are more vulnerable to nutrient burn and lockout.

(Courtesy of GroBox) Different products used include rockwool, vermiculite, expanded clay pebbles, perlite, and coco coir, just to name a few. Commercial soilless blends are widely offered that integrate two or more of these media to create an enhanced growing mix. Soilless media can be used in automated hydroponic setups or in hand-watered specific containers.

A flood-and-drain, tray-style hydroponic system may utilize little net pots filled with clay pebbles or simply a big slab of rockwool to grow many little plants, while a "super-soil" grow might utilize 10 gallon nursery pots to grow a few big plants. Affordable alternatives include disposable perforated plastic bags or cloth bags, while some select to spend more on "clever pots," containers that are developed to enhance airflow to the plant's root zone.

Drain is key, however, as marijuana plants are very delicate to water-logged conditions, so if you repurpose other containers, make certain to drill holes in the bottoms and set them in trays. Growing high-quality cannabis flowers needs more fertilizer, or nutrients, than most typical crops. Your plant needs the following primary nutrients (collectively referred to as macronutrients): Nitrogen (N) Phosphorus (P) Potassium (K) These micronutrients are required also, albeit in much smaller amounts: Calcium Magnesium Iron Copper If you aren't utilizing a pre-fertilized organic soil mix, you will require to feed your plants a minimum of as soon as a week utilizing an appropriate nutrient service.

This is due to the fact that marijuana has changing macronutrient requirements during its lifecycle, requiring more nitrogen throughout vegetative growth, and more phosphorus and potassium during bud production. Many macronutrients are offered in a two-part liquid to avoid certain elements from precipitating (combining into an inert solid that is unusable by the plant), implying you'll require to purchase two bottles (part A and part B) for veg, and 2 bottles for grow, in addition to a bottle of micronutrients.

When you've acquired the needed nutrient items, just blend them with water as directed by the label and water your plants with this service. You must always start at half-strength since marijuana plants are quickly burned. It's nearly constantly even worse to overfeed your plants than to underfeed them, and in time you will discover to "check out" your plants for indications of shortages or excesses.

Furthermore, some places may have high levels of chlorine in the water supply, which can be hazardous to helpful soil microorganisms. For these factors, lots of people pick to filter the water they use in their gardens. The most crucial thing to bear in mind during this phase is to not overwater. Cannabis plants are really prone to fungal root diseases when conditions are too damp, and overwatering is one of the most common mistakes made by the starting grower.

As you have actually heard- and will most likely hear a lot in this guide- all plants are various and will need different growing environments. For instance, sativa plants like to grow very tall and produce smaller sized buds come harvest. Kushes and cookie marijuana pressures (hybrids and indicator plants) tend to be bushier and can offer you fatter buds come harvest time.
